Kagami Biraki 2010 (Opening Ceremony) Sunday January 17, 2010 – 1:00 pm
The Newmarket Budokan Judo Club invites you to attend our yearly Kagami Biraki.
Kagami Biraki literally means "Mirror Opening" (also known as the "Rice Cutting Ceremony"). It is a traditional Japanese celebration that is held in many traditional martial arts schools. It was an old samurai tradition dating back to the 15th century that was adopted into modern martial arts starting in 1884 when Jigoro Kano (the founder of judo) instituted the custom at the Kodokan, his organization's headquarters.
